LTO holds Road Safety Seminar at BulSU

Auto industry zooms with double-digit sales growth every year. Also, the growing number of driving individuals conforms to the increasing occurrence of road accidents every single day. That is why safety precautions are a must to be discussed to serve as a reminder for the do's and don'ts on the road. In line with this, the Land Transportation Office (LTO) held its Road Safety Awareness Seminar in partnership with the Bulacan State University (BulSU) last August 28, 2019 at the Valencia Hall.

The University President Dr. Cecilia S. Navasero-Gascon together with the Provincial Governor of Bulacan Hon. Daniel Fernando, University Vice Presidents, College Deans, faculty and students attended the program.

Atty. Sushen Sison from the Legal Office of LTO Region III explained that accidents are due to reckless driving. She reiterated that if phone were not used to text someone while driving nor people are not over speeding, accidents could possibly be avoided. The importance of following the traffic laws is for the safety of the many.

Meanwhile, Dr. Gascon on her speech, cited a report from Inquirer.net where the sample data revealed that the statistics on vehicular accidents which has doubled in ten years from 2007-2017 is equivalent to almost 300 cases of accidents or 12 cases every hour in Metro Manila, while roughly 34 road crashes every day in the province. She asserted in her speech, “This seminar on Road Safety Awareness is both timely and significant, for it could arrest a problem that claim lives and properties of many Filipinos. “

The University President thanked the organizers of the event, and assured LTO that BulSU will always be one with them in promoting road safety through proper information on laws, rules, and regulations pertinent to land transportation.
